Senior Python Engineer for AI call agents platform
Back-End Web
Summary
Project Description
We're looking for a Senior AI Engineer for a dynamic pre-seed startup with about 5 team members. The startup is revolutionizing customer service through Gen AI and telephony.
The team works on intelligent AI-driven solutions for communication automation.
- The external chat assistant integrates into websites to engage with users, while the internal chat assistant optimizes knowledge management within companies.
- The external call assistant automates outbound calls, such as client outreach or debt collection, and the internal call assistant handles incoming calls, enhancing the efficiency of support and customer service operations.
What You'll Do:
- Key contributor to the development of our AI platform's backend, ensuring robust and scalable architecture.
- Collaborate closely with our small, agile team to implement backend services using Azure Function Apps and manage APIs.
- Manage and optimize databases, including Cosmos DB for live data and user profiles.
- Integrate AI models using Azure OpenAI and Azure AI Studio for advanced search and response functionalities.
- Ensure seamless integration with our AI call agent platform.
- Handle telephony integrations with Twilio or VoxImplant for smooth customer interactions.
- Innovate and contribute to the overall architecture and design of our platform, focusing on scalability and performance.
Requirements:
- Proven track record in backend development with experience in microservices architecture and cloud platforms, specifically Azure.
- Azure Cloud: Azure cloud services such as Cosmos DB, Azure OpenAI, Azure AI Studio, Azure Functions, Azure API Management, etc.
- Telephony platforms such as VoxImplant and/or Twilio
- Languages: Python, C#
Why join the project?
- Be part of an early-stage company with big ambitions and the opportunity to shape the future of AI in customer service.
- Work in a small, close-knit team where your contributions are recognized and valued.
- Flexible work environment, allowing you to balance work and life.